#include <bits/stdc++.h>
#include "Anthony.h"
using namespace std;

const string dbmc = "\033[1;38;2;57;197;187m", dbrs = "\033[0m";

#define fs first
#define sc second
#define mp make_pair
#define FOR(i, j, k) for (int i = j, Z = k; i < Z; i++)
typedef pair<int, int> pii;

namespace {
    const int MXN = 20005;
    int n, m, A, B;
    vector<int> eu, ev;
    vector<int> eid[MXN];
    int d[MXN];
    vector<int> tag;

    namespace NSA {
        void BSH(int sr) {
            fill(d, d + n, -1);
            queue<pii> q;
            q.push(mp(0, sr));
            while (q.size()) {
                auto [dep, id] = q.front();
                q.pop();
                if (d[id] != -1) continue;
                d[id] = dep;
                for (auto &e : eid[id]) {
                    int i = eu[e] ^ ev[e] ^ id;
                    if (d[i] != -1) continue;
                    q.push(mp(dep + 1, i));
                }
            }
        }

        vector<int> Mark() {
            BSH(0);
            tag.resize(m);
            FOR(i, 0, m) {
                if (d[eu[i]] == d[ev[i]]) tag[i] = d[eu[i]] % 3;
                else tag[i] = min(d[eu[i]], d[ev[i]]) % 3;
            }
            return tag;
        }
    }

    namespace NSB {
        vector<int> Mark() {
            return vector<int>();
        }
    }
}

vector<int> Mark(int _n, int _m, int _a, int _b, vector<int> _eu, vector<int> _ev) {
    n = _n;
    m = _m;
    A = _a;
    B = _b;
    eu = _eu;
    ev = _ev;
    FOR(i, 0, m) {
        eid[eu[i]].push_back(i);
        eid[ev[i]].push_back(i);
    }
    return (A >= 3 ? NSA::Mark() : NSB::Mark());
}
#include <bits/stdc++.h>
#include "Catherine.h"
using namespace std;

#define fs first
#define sc second
#define mp make_pair
#define FOR(i, j, k) for (int i = j, Z = k; i < Z; i++)
typedef pair<int, int> pii;

namespace {
    int A, B;

    namespace NSA {
        int Move(vector<int> &y) {
            int a = y[0], b = y[1], c = y[2];
            int cnt = (a != 0) + (b != 0) + (c != 0);
            if (cnt == 1) return (a ? 0 : (b ? 1 : 2));
            return (a == 0 ? 1 : (b == 0 ? 2 : 0));
        }
    }

    namespace NSB {
        int Move(vector<int> &y) {
            return -1;
        }
    }
}

void Init(int _a, int _b) {
    A = _a;
    B = _b;
}

int Move(vector<int> y) {
    return (A >= 3 ? NSA::Move(y) : NSB::Move(y));
}
